From: Chris Hanson Date: Fri, 17 Apr 1987 00:58:33 +0000 (+0000) Subject: Eliminate use of `mapcar', clean up some other things too. X-Git-Tag: 20090517-FFI~13621 X-Git-Url: https://birchwood-abbey.net/git?a=commitdiff_plain;h=de0681d78bf4f2311fc5e5d32e82d461f442b7e2;p=mit-scheme.git Eliminate use of `mapcar', clean up some other things too. --- diff --git a/v7/src/runtime/boot.scm b/v7/src/runtime/boot.scm index 612a2b171..f64819b4d 100644 --- a/v7/src/runtime/boot.scm +++ b/v7/src/runtime/boot.scm @@ -1,6 +1,6 @@ ;;; -*-Scheme-*- ;;; -;;; $Header: /Users/cph/tmp/foo/mit-scheme/mit-scheme/v7/src/runtime/boot.scm,v 13.42 1987/02/11 02:21:11 cph Exp $ +;;; $Header: /Users/cph/tmp/foo/mit-scheme/mit-scheme/v7/src/runtime/boot.scm,v 13.43 1987/04/17 00:58:33 cph Rel $ ;;; ;;; Copyright (c) 1987 Massachusetts Institute of Technology ;;; @@ -50,9 +50,9 @@ (let-syntax ((define-global-primitives (macro names `(BEGIN - ,@(mapcar (lambda (name) - `(DEFINE ,name ,(make-primitive-procedure name))) - names))))) + ,@(map (lambda (name) + `(DEFINE ,name ,(make-primitive-procedure name))) + names))))) (define-global-primitives SCODE-EVAL FORCE WITH-THREADED-CONTINUATION SET-INTERRUPT-ENABLES! WITH-INTERRUPTS-REDUCED @@ -139,5 +139,4 @@ (define (boolean? object) (or (eq? object #F) - (eq? object #T))) (eq? object #T))) \ No newline at end of file